Active site

Catalytic triadSer162 · His240 · Asp210
Ser OG → His NE21.80 Å
His ND1 → Asp OD3.45 Å
Oxyanion donor 1163 (4.00 Å)
Oxyanion donor 292 (4.17 Å)
Cleft width20.25 Å
Cleft depth4.81 Å
Cleft residues73

Aromatic clamp: PHE122 · PHE222 · PHE241 · PHE242 · PHE92 · TRP161 · TRP189 · TRP96

Identifiers and cross-references

Library entry 1630 (WP_116180173.1) in the Science 2025 PET depolymerase landscape. Product release 704 +/- 27.5 uM, classed ACTIVE against its own replicate noise (active above 2 SD, inactive at or below 1 SD). Source: Landscape profiling of PET depolymerases using a natural sequence cluster framework, Science 2025 (doi:10.1126/science.adp5637), Data S3.
